## Authentication

The Pennygate payments API requires every retry of a charge request to carry the same idempotency key as the original attempt. Generate keys client-side and persist them before the first call; the Murdock ledger service deduplicates on that key for 24 hours. Never mint a fresh key on retry, or you risk double charges. All requests to the sandbox environment are authenticated with a bearer header. For your contractor sandbox account, use the bearer token below.

session JWT of hahif-fawif = eyJhbGciOiJIUzI1NiIsInR5cCI6IkpXVCJ9.eyJzdWIiOiI04_V2KayaDIn0.-jKHPhS5t5LS

Ticket PACE-341: Config drift on StrideGate chip readers

Readers at the Harwick Marathon finish line report a 40 MHz antenna setting; fleet baseline is 38 MHz. Drift likely introduced during last week's manual field patch. Three units affected, dedupe window also mismatched. Re-sync before Saturday. The expected baseline configuration is pasted below.

config for kagup-hahig:
druwyn:
  pin: 2801
  metrics_host: metrics.druwyn.zemvarlabs.internal
  tenant: sorius
  seal: seal_798a43d7

# Nightloom Environments

Nightloom schedules nightly data backfills across three environments: sandbox, staging, prod. Plugin authors get sandbox access only; staging requires a signed plugin manifest. Jobs in sandbox run hourly rather than nightly to speed testing. APIs are identical across environments. Plugins should read the environment settings shown below.

settings of bawif-fawif:
ralix:
  log_level: warn
  metrics_host: metrics.ralix.tolvaqsys.internal
  pool_size: 32

Ticket #4182 — Consent banner rollout blocked by locked vault

Heads up, future folks: the Bannerline consent-banner rollout for the Quillmark sites stalled because the deploy vault auto-locked after three bad unlock attempts (thanks, stale CI token). The banner config and regional consent strings live in that vault, so nothing ships until it's reopened. Marit already rotated the CI token, so once the vault is unsealed, just rerun the pipeline and it should go green. To unseal it, use the recovery passphrase below.

strongbox words: prawyn-fenmir